Output 584092d162af73edab1217acc82568de4a69388f1a133c4fa3e87a5894658314:1

value
305592
script pubkey
OP_0 OP_PUSHBYTES_20 45ef1d5a6b83dd74ef7ee68a29346205a77f4d98
address
bc1qghh36knts0whfmm7u69zjdrzqknh7nvc6zpjz3
transaction
584092d162af73edab1217acc82568de4a69388f1a133c4fa3e87a5894658314
spent
true